In places in which fire bans are in place, it’s important to Check out Using the nearby authorities before beginning any fire. There may very well be allowances or limits on specific gas types or no-burn evenings set up.

Protection Security is among the largest aspects to think about when positioning a fire pit within your backyard or campsite. You’ll often have to have to put it in a region no less than 20 toes from the house and away from hanging trees or vegetation. It need to by no means be less than an overhang or inside of a partly-enclosed House. The surface it sits on is equally essential. “In lieu of putting it straight on a wooden deck or dry grass, go with a non-flammable surface like stone,” states Anne Puukko, founder of Superdwell. Steer clear of putting the fire pit on combustible surfaces Wood Burning Fire Pit for example wood, vinyl, stamped concrete, or composite flooring without having a stand, and rather choose amount locations made from Filth, gravel or stone. Should you’re buying a propane fire pit, Mitch Brean, founder of Stone Property advises to “know your fillers and pick safe resources like lava stone or fire glass.” For additional protection, Bryan Clayton, CEO at GreenPal endorses employing a spark display screen and keeping a fire extinguisher or h2o close by. “If you're completed, make certain the fire is completely out before you go away,” he claims. Last of all, Puukko recommends thinking of climatic conditions right before sitting out with the fire. “While the dancing flames may very well be mesmerizing, It is also clever to avoid utilizing the pit on quite windy times.”
